Transaction 664389d89298d8cc7a9cf55902865845819f616b05936af88c7ba83bc5b7a5a0
1 Input
1 Output
-
664389d89298d8cc7a9cf55902865845819f616b05936af88c7ba83bc5b7a5a0:0
- value
- 167196
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6bd40e8bcb514984c92369d4c7a688b26afdcf7b OP_EQUAL
- address
- 3BXAG32i458WZFbaPHqVh8adEsXNPAAF8L